AI Coding Models Comparison: Find Your Perfect Match
Explore the leading AI coding models comparison. Discover which AI tools best suit your development needs and boost your productivity. Read now!

In today's rapidly evolving tech landscape, Artificial Intelligence (AI) is no longer a futuristic concept but a present-day powerhouse, transforming industries and workflows. For developers, AI coding models are becoming indispensable tools, offering assistance with everything from writing boilerplate code to debugging complex issues. But with a growing array of powerful AI models available, choosing the right one can be a daunting task. This article provides a comprehensive AI coding models comparison to help you identify the best fit for your development needs.
The Rise of AI in Software Development
AI's integration into software development is revolutionizing how we code. These intelligent systems can understand natural language, analyze code, generate new code snippets, and even suggest optimizations. They act as powerful assistants, augmenting developer capabilities and accelerating the entire development lifecycle. Whether you're a seasoned professional or just starting, leveraging AI can significantly enhance your productivity and the quality of your work.
From auto-completion that predicts your next line of code to sophisticated models that can generate entire functions based on a simple prompt, AI is democratizing complex coding tasks. This shift allows developers to focus more on creative problem-solving and architectural design, rather than getting bogged down in repetitive or intricate coding details.
Key AI Coding Models to Consider
Several AI models stand out for their capabilities in assisting with coding tasks. Each has its strengths, catering to different aspects of the development process. Understanding these differences is crucial for making an informed decision.
- GPT-4 and its variants: OpenAI's Generative Pre-trained Transformer models have set a high bar for natural language understanding and code generation. GPT-4, in particular, is known for its advanced reasoning capabilities and proficiency across multiple programming languages.
- Gemini: Google's Gemini family of models, including Gemini Pro and Gemini Flash, offers robust performance in understanding context and generating code. Its integration within Google's ecosystem also provides unique advantages.
- Grok: Developed by xAI, Grok aims to provide real-time information access and a unique conversational style, which can be beneficial for developers seeking up-to-the-minute insights or a different approach to problem-solving.
- Claude: Anthropic's Claude models are recognized for their strong performance in handling long contexts and providing detailed, helpful responses, making them suitable for complex coding tasks and documentation.
- Specialized Models: Beyond these general-purpose giants, numerous specialized AI coding assistants are emerging, often fine-tuned for specific languages or tasks like unit testing or code refactoring.
AI Coding Models Comparison: Performance and Features
When comparing AI coding models, several factors come into play: code generation quality, understanding of complex prompts, debugging capabilities, language support, speed, and cost.
Code Generation Quality
The primary function for many developers is code generation. Models like GPT-4 and Gemini often excel here, producing syntactically correct and contextually relevant code snippets. The quality can vary based on the complexity of the request and the specificity of the prompt. For instance, generating boilerplate code or implementing standard algorithms is typically straightforward for most advanced models.
Understanding Complex Prompts
Developers often need AI to interpret intricate requirements. Models with larger context windows and advanced reasoning capabilities, such as GPT-4 and Claude, tend to perform better when dealing with multi-part instructions or abstract coding concepts. This ability is critical for translating high-level requirements into functional code.
Debugging and Error Detection
AI assistants can be invaluable for debugging. They can analyze error messages, suggest potential fixes, and even identify logical flaws in the code. While most leading models offer some level of debugging assistance, specialized tools or models fine-tuned for error detection might offer superior performance in this area.
Language and Framework Support
Most top-tier AI coding models support a wide range of popular programming languages (Python, JavaScript, Java, C++, etc.) and frameworks. However, the depth of understanding and the quality of generated code can differ. Developers working with less common languages might need to test models more rigorously to ensure adequate support.
Speed and Latency
The speed at which an AI model generates a response is crucial for a smooth workflow. Models like Gemini Flash or Grok Fast are designed for speed, offering quicker responses that can be beneficial for real-time coding assistance. However, speed might sometimes come at the cost of depth or complexity in the generated output.
Cost and Accessibility
Access to these powerful AI models often comes with a price. Many offer tiered subscription plans or pay-as-you-go models. For developers looking for cost-effective solutions, exploring free tiers, open-source alternatives, or models specifically designed for efficiency is a good strategy. Platforms like GridStack offer access to a variety of these models, allowing users to compare and choose based on their needs and budget.
Попробуйте GridStack бесплатно
10+ AI моделей, генерация изображений, быстрые ответы и бесплатные ежедневные лимиты в одном Telegram-боте.
Открыть ботаGridStack: Your Gateway to Top AI Coding Models
Navigating the landscape of AI coding models can be simplified with a platform that aggregates access to multiple leading options. GridStack provides a unified interface to interact with various powerful AI models, including:
- GPT-5 mini/nano & GPT-4.1 mini/nano: Access to the latest iterations of OpenAI's powerful language models for advanced coding assistance.
- Gemini 3 Flash, Gemini 2.5 Flash/Lite: Leverage Google's cutting-edge Gemini models for versatile coding tasks.
- Grok 4.1 Fast, Grok 4 Fast: Utilize xAI's innovative models for real-time insights and rapid code generation.
GridStack also includes access to image generation models like Nano Banana Pro and Nano Banana 2, which can be useful for generating UI mockups or visual assets related to your projects.
This consolidated access allows developers to experiment with different models, compare their performance on specific coding tasks, and ultimately choose the AI that best aligns with their workflow and project requirements. Instead of managing multiple subscriptions and interfaces, GridStack offers a streamlined experience.
Choosing the Right AI Model for Your Needs
Deciding which AI coding model is best depends heavily on your specific requirements. Here’s a guide to help you make that choice:
- For General-Purpose Coding & Complex Tasks: Models like GPT-4.1 or Claude 4.5 offer strong all-around performance and are excellent for understanding complex instructions and generating detailed code. They are also great for tasks like refactoring and debugging.
- For Speed and Efficiency: If rapid code generation and quick responses are your priority, consider Gemini Flash or Grok Fast. These models are optimized for speed, making them ideal for real-time coding assistance or generating large volumes of code quickly.
- For Exploration and Versatility: Gemini 2.5 offers a balance of capability and accessibility, making it a good choice for developers who want to explore various AI coding functionalities without committing to the most advanced (and often most expensive) options.
- For Open-Source Enthusiasts: While not explicitly listed in the GridStack offerings above, it's worth noting that open-source models are also a growing area. For developers preferring local or more customizable solutions, exploring options like Llama or Mistral might be beneficial (though these might require separate setup). The article Llama 4 vs Mistral Comparison touches upon this aspect.
- For Beginners: Free tiers or more accessible models can be a great starting point. Many platforms offer limited free access, allowing users to test the waters before investing. The articles AI Coding for Free and Best Free AI Chatbots can provide more insights into free options.
Best Practices for Using AI Coding Models
To maximize the benefits of AI coding models, adopt these best practices:
- Be Specific with Prompts: The clearer and more detailed your prompt, the better the AI's output will be. Include programming language, desired functionality, constraints, and examples.
- Iterate and Refine: Don't expect perfection on the first try. Treat AI-generated code as a starting point. Refine prompts and iterate on the output to achieve the desired result.
- Review and Understand: Always review the code generated by AI. Understand how it works, check for potential bugs or security vulnerabilities, and ensure it aligns with your project's standards. Never blindly copy-paste code.
- Use for Learning: AI coding models can be excellent learning tools. Ask them to explain code snippets, demonstrate concepts, or provide alternative solutions to problems. This can deepen your understanding of programming.
- Combine Tools: Don't limit yourself to a single AI model. Use different models for different tasks. For instance, one model might excel at generating UI code, while another is better for backend logic.
The Future of AI in Coding
The trajectory of AI in coding is one of increasing sophistication and integration. We can expect AI models to become even more adept at understanding complex software architectures, predicting potential issues before they arise, and collaborating more seamlessly with human developers. Autonomous agents, capable of taking on larger software development tasks with minimal human intervention, are already on the horizon, as hinted at in guides like GPT-5 Autonomous Agents Setup.
The AI coding models comparison landscape will continue to evolve, with new models emerging and existing ones constantly improving. Staying informed and experimenting with different tools will be key for developers to remain at the forefront of technological advancement.
Conclusion
Choosing the right AI coding model is a strategic decision that can significantly impact a developer's efficiency and effectiveness. By understanding the strengths and weaknesses of leading models like GPT, Gemini, and Grok, and by utilizing platforms like GridStack for easy access and comparison, developers can harness the power of AI to its fullest potential. This AI coding models comparison serves as a starting point for your journey into leveraging AI for better, faster, and more innovative coding practices. Remember to always review, understand, and refine the AI's output to ensure high-quality and secure code.
Попробуйте GridStack бесплатно
10+ AI моделей, генерация изображений, быстрые ответы и бесплатные ежедневные лимиты в одном Telegram-боте.
Открыть бота